My Father - as we approach the end of Q1 2024; I am sincerely grateful for all that you have done for me this year. Your faithfulness in keeping my family under the shadow of  compassion, good health and favour cannot be taken for granted.

We are in a period where we desperately need the heavens to open and for your Holy Spirit to pour out upon us all the gifts that only he can provide. I know the mandate that you have given me but I have been struggling to build up enough momentum to kick start the process

Perhaps this is the root of the problem - relying on my own strength instead of committing all my plans under the framework of your grace and empowerment.

I guess this is why Mary in her confused state said “How can this be….and you allayed her fears by telling her that the Holy Spirit will come upon her and the empowerment will come from the Holy Spirit  because with you nothing is impossible.

So Lord, as we are approaching Q2 2024, I commit my role as a Husband, Father and Ambassador Christ to you and ask for the Holy Spirt to empower me to achieve the impossible.

Align my every path to fulfil your instruction to Occupy Till You Come Again

It was quite interesting how you used a conversation between two friends in the gym about their plans to detox from social media as it was a distraction and they are looking to utilise the time freed up for things of value.

Lord remove all distractions from my life that are are limiting my focus on things of godly value that really matter because you have advised us that we will be accountable for every word, though and deed

May your grace continue to be operational in my life and until the next board meeting - keep us well and safe
